Easy Green Bean With Lemon And Garlic

  • Total Time: 10 minutes
  • Yield: 4 people 1x

Description

Perfectly sauteed green beans simmered with fresh garlic and finished off with a hint of lemon. A simple healthy side dish that is ready in 10 minutes, easy to make, vegan, gluten-free, and kid-friendly.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 1.5 lbs green beans (ends trimmed)
  • 1/4 tsp kosher salt
  • 1/8 tsp ground black pepper
  • 2 cloves of garlic (minced)
  • 2 tbsp water or vegetable stock
  • 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ice (from the juice of 1 lemon)

Instructions

  1. Heat a cast-iron or heavy-bottomed pan to medium heat and add in 2 tablespoons of olive oil.
  2. Once the oil is hot, add in the green beans and toss them in the oil. Sprinkle in the salt and pepper and toss again. Let that cook for about 4-5 minutes to get the green beans slightly browned and tender.
  3. Add in the garlic and toss, let that cook for 1-2 minutes.
  4. Pour in the 2 tablespoons of water or vegetable stock, cover the pan, reduce to simmer, and let the green beans simmer for 3-4 minutes.
  5. Remove the lid, sprinkle in the lemon juice and more salt and pepper if needed. Toss and plate warm with a dash of red pepper flakes.

Notes

  • How do you trim green beans? Line the beans up in a bunch so the ends are all even and place them onto a cutting board. Use a sharp kitchen knife to cut off the tough fibrous ends.
  • Use good quality fresh green beans. Since this recipe only contains a few ingredients, it is important that you choose the freshest green beans you can find at local farmers’ markets or higher-end grocery stores like whole foods and Earthfare. Or simply opt for bulk organic greens beans that are typically available at most local grocery stores.
  • Use a cast-iron pan if you have one. The cast-iron pan just gives this recipe a good punch of flavor. If you do not have a cast-iron pan then any heavy-bottomed pan with a lid will work.
  • Opt for fresh lemon juice. Again, since this recipe only calls for a few simple ingredients, you want to make sure you use the juice from a fresh lemon rather than bottled lemon juice.
